Output 704a18c0b76fcbb8dd5ea8c76f75f39e2a38faaa39a66d8042b1448a7c0d3935:1

value
490555627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 018c96a38e14029e9bbbdfbab902a663be6abb04 OP_EQUAL
address
M83MKsrWVe1dqwqYTYP5ZWvNQqC25UPcQw
transaction
704a18c0b76fcbb8dd5ea8c76f75f39e2a38faaa39a66d8042b1448a7c0d3935
spent
true